This
hotel
is
okay,
but
all
the
hotels
nearby
seem
nicer
and
better
positioned.
My
room
was
comfortable
and
had
a
nice
view
(29th
floor),
but
the
walls
are
thin
and
I
could
hear
my
neighbors
most
nights.
Also,
the
hotel
is
positioned
in
a
place
that
requires
crossing
busy
roads
to
get
to
anything
else,
which
means
you
get
plenty
of
traffic
noise
and
noise
from
the
microbus
lot
next
door.
Watch
out
for
the
service
charge.
It’s
an
affordable
option,
but
the
service
charge
is
kinda
steep
and
they
don’t
tell
you
what/who
it
is
for.
They
still
included
a
tip
on
the
room
service
so
it’s
clearly
not
for
that,
but
who
knows
what
it’s
going
toward.
The
elevator
system
is
really
outdated
for
being
such
a
large
hotel,
so
plan
a
lot
of
extra
time
to
deal
with
elevators.
Many
times,
while
riding
up
in
an
elevator,
it
would
stop
on
a
floor
where
someone
was
trying
to
go
down
and
it
would
add
time
and
confusion.
Sometimes
I
would
also
see
the
elevator
just
pass
my
floor
without
stopping.
They
are
renovating
the
elevators,
but
unless
they
update
the
call
system
to
something
more
modern
it
will
probably
still
be
slow.
Cleaning
and
lounge
staff
are
all
kind.
Guest
services
called
every
evening
my
first
few
days
in
town
to
check
how
I
was
enjoying
my
stay
-
while
this
was
polite,
it
was
a
bit
irritating
having
the
room
phone
ring
every
evening
while
trying
to
relax.
My
biggest
complaint
is
that
during
checkout,
I
asked
if
I
had
taken
anything
from
the
minibar.
I
told
the
woman
at
the
desk
yes
and
described
what
I
had
taken,
but
then
I
had
to
wait
more
than
five
extra
minutes
while
she
called
upstairs
to
confirm.
If
they’re
not
gonna
believe
you
anyway,
there’s
no
point
in
asking
you
and
treating
you
like
a
liar.
Don’t
waste
a
person’s
time
and
insult
them
too.
Outside
all
this,
it’s
a
modest
hotel
with
reasonable
amenities
and
comfort.
This
wasn’t
a
bad
stay,
but
it’s
not
the
best
hotel
around.
I
made
the
jump
from
Marriott
to
Hilton
this
year
after
a
lot
of
disappointing
Marriott
experiences,
and
this
is
my
first
time
experiencing
any
mild
disappointment.
Won’t
stay
again,
but
go
for
it
if
you
need
a
cheaper
option
downtown.
